When you search for "Megan is Missing subtitles," you will encounter two types of files:
Soft Subs (SRT, ASS, SSA): These are separate text files. They allow you to change font, size, and color. Recommendation: Use soft subs. Hard Subs (Burned-in): These are permanently drawn onto the video image. Many YouTube uploads have hard-coded Spanish or Portuguese subtitles. You cannot remove them. If you find subtitles synced to the 85-minute cut but you are watching the 112-minute cut, the subs will desync entirely around the 70-minute mark. Worse, if your subtitles are for the censored UK version, they will remove all text descriptions during the final photo sequence—which defeats the purpose of having them.
Check your runtime. If your video file is 1 hour and 52 minutes, you need the "Unrated" subtitle pack. Do not settle.
If you are streaming the movie on Tubi, Amazon Prime, or YouTube Movies, the platform provides legally mandated closed captions. However, users frequently complain that these versions are often "dubbed" or "censored" for graphic content. The captions here will match the edited version, not the original uncut film.
